AMD RX-418GD or AMD Ryzen Threadripper PRO 7975WX - which processor is faster? In this comparison we look at the differences and analyze which of these two CPUs is better. We compare the technical data and benchmark results.

The AMD RX-418GD has 4 cores with 4 threads and clocks with a maximum frequency of 3.20 GHz. Up to GB of memory is supported in 2 memory channels. The AMD RX-418GD was released in Q4/2015.

The AMD Ryzen Threadripper PRO 7975WX has 32 cores with 64 threads and clocks with a maximum frequency of 5.30 GHz. The CPU supports up to 2048 GB of memory in 8 memory channels. The AMD Ryzen Threadripper PRO 7975WX was released in Q4/2023.

Memory & PCIe

The AMD RX-418GD can use up to GB of memory in 2 memory channels. The maximum memory bandwidth is 38.4 GB/s. The AMD Ryzen Threadripper PRO 7975WX supports up to 2048 GB of memory in 8 memory channels and achieves a memory bandwidth of up to 332.8 GB/s.

Thermal Management

The thermal design power (TDP for short) of the AMD RX-418GD is 35 W, while the AMD Ryzen Threadripper PRO 7975WX has a TDP of 350 W. The TDP specifies the necessary cooling solution that is required to cool the processor sufficiently.

Technical details

The AMD RX-418GD is manufactured in 28 nm and has 2.00 MB cache. The AMD Ryzen Threadripper PRO 7975WX is manufactured in 5 nm and has a 160.00 MB cache.
